英文摘要 | In x-ray grating-based phase contrast imaging, information retrieval is necessary for quantitative research, especially for phase tomography. however, numerous and repetitive processes have to be performed for tomographic reconstruction. in this paper, we report a novel information retrieval method, which enables retrieving phase and absorption information by means of a linear combination of two mutually conjugate images. thanks to the distributive law of the multiplication as well as the commutative law and associative law of the addition, the information retrieval can be performed after tomographic reconstruction, thus simplifying the information retrieval procedure dramatically. the theoretical model of this method is established in both parallel beam geometry for talbot interferometer and fan beam geometry for talbot-lau interferometer. numerical experiments are also performed to confirm the feasibility and validity of the proposed method. in addition, we discuss its possibility in cone beam geometry and its advantages compared with other methods. moreover, this method can also be employed in other differential phase contrast imaging methods, such as diffraction enhanced imaging, non-interferometric imaging, and edge illumination. published by aip publishing. |
